If you don’t do serious surgery to the culture of your company you won’t successfully transform Stake bold positions and work backwards Key an eye on La Presse and Aftonbladet’s mobile-first revolution Fast will eat slow. Big won’t always beat small. Simple will always replace the complex Successful companies are in sharp conflict with something in community that makes them unique Day 1 – Key takeaways

Digital natives, print natives are locked in. Our battle is for digital immigrants Renting versus owning News media consumption is become an out-of-home medium Schibsted: Transformation needs to be faster The identified is replacing the anonymous More data means more relevant TAKE AWAYS… 2

Long-form news emerged as the success story: young people do care about news Vice News’ mantra: Listen to your audience, quality and authenticity are the most important metrics, content has to travel, treat the internet with respect, be brave in your decisions Use social to enhance your story telling, as Prezi did NZZ: create and encourage diverse teams, break down the change agenda into digestible chunks Include creating the right community from the project outset TAKE AWAYS… 3

Teams need to be like swiss army knives Vice News: two week onboarding for new staff Time to collaborate: prioritise face-to-face planning. Fail fast: two week sprints. Clear focus: user-oriented goals Bridge brands and Gen Y Not clicks, but shares Start-ups succeed because they have skin in the game We need to measure engagement time with advertising TAKE AWAYS… 4

People are blocking ads for legitimate reasons: accept it Mobile will be the apocalypse of ad blocking Native video could be part of the solution Advertising will need to become more engaging to avoid blocking Schibsted: merge the competencies of all your teams The hack day works for strategy development You need to facilitate collaboration and liberate staff Don’t be afraid of merging the ends of the burning rope TAKE AWAYS… 5
